How do I back up my Outlook 2007 contacts?

I have reinstall Windows on my machine and I am looking for an easy way to
back up my contacts. Last time i followed Outlooks directions it didn't work.
Someone suggested saving them to a Excel file. Does that work, and how do you
do it?

I have trial software called "outback plus" does it work and will it save my
contact information?

Thanks in advance!

Just make a copy of your pst file. that's all you have to do. (With Outlook
closed of course...)
